TriCare is an insurance plan issued by the United States Defense Health Agency offered to active military personnel, veterans, and their families. The equipment used in TMS is FDA- cleared to treat Depression, and in 2016, TriCare approved coverage for TMS therapy for Depression.

How it Works

TriCare West is the insurance provider that serves the Western region of the United States. We accept all three levels of insurance: TriCare Prime, TriCare Reserve, and TriCare Select for the treatment of depression.

TriCare Prime

If you have TriCare Prime, you may need a referral from your primary care physician or other medical provider. After your initial consultation with us, we may ask you to request a referral to see us for treatment for Depression. Additionally, we will set up a call to review the required Letter of Attestation. We will submit this on your behalf to accompany the referral to TriCare. You may have questions about this, and we are happy to help guide you through this process.

TriCare Reserve

If you are suffering from Depression and have TriCare Reserve, you do not need a referral submitted to TriCare from your primary care provider. TriCare Select

If your coverage is TriCare Select, and you are suffering from depression, you do not need a referral from your primary care provider. TriCare Coverage Specifications

TriCare coverage will only apply if you are experiencing Depression as your primary diagnosis, if you are over 18, and have tried previous treatments, such as medications, that were unsuccessful. TriCare coverage may be denied if you have Other Health Insurance (OHI). Please be sure to specify if you currently carry OHI.

While we will walk you through all the steps, it is important to mention that if you have Prime and need a referral, your PCP will need to submit the referral to TriCare on your behalf. Please note that your PCP will also need to indicate our physician’s name and contact information on the referral to TriCare.
